Ingredients

2 tomatoes , chopped
1 -2 jalapeno , seeded and chopped
1/2 onion , chopped
2 garlic cloves , chopped
1 teaspoon fresh oregano , chopped
1/4 teaspoon chili pow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
4 corn tortillas ( or flour )
1 cup shredded iceberg lettuce
1/4 cup reduced-fat monterey jack cheese , shredded
4 eggs , cooked sunny side up ( or over light )
If you love the flavors of Mexican cuisine, you will enjoy this breakfast wrap. The jalapeno-infused tomato and onion mixture adds a spicy twist to the breakfast classic of eggs and cheese. This wrap can be served with salsa or avocado to add even more flavor and nutrition. It is an easy and quick breakfast option that can be made with minimal effort and is enjoyable for the whole family.

Instructions

1.In a large pan on medium heat, cook the tomatoes, jalapeno, onion, garlic, oregano, chili powder, and salt for around 5 minutes until everything is soft and cooked.
2.Heat the tortillas as per the package instructions.
3.Top each tortilla with the cooked mixture, shredded lettuce, cheese, and an egg cooked sunny side up or over light.
4.Wrap up the tortilla and enjoy while it's hot.
